The Benefits Of Using EDM Machining Services For Precision Component Manufacturing

When it comes to manufacturing precision components, one of the most effective methods is electrical discharge machining (EDM) This process involves using electrical discharges to remove material from a workpiece in order to shape it into the desired form EDM machining services offer several advantages over traditional machining methods, making it a popular choice for industries that require high accuracy and tight tolerances.

One of the main benefits of EDM machining services is the ability to produce complex shapes and intricate designs with high precision Unlike traditional machining methods such as milling or turning, which can be limited by the geometry of the cutting tool, EDM can create shapes that are impossible to achieve with conventional tools This makes it an ideal choice for manufacturing components with intricate details or tight tolerances.

Another advantage of EDM machining services is the ability to work with hard materials that are difficult to machine using traditional methods This includes materials such as hardened steel, titanium, and carbide, which are commonly used in industries such as aerospace, automotive, and medical device manufacturing The non-contact nature of EDM means that there is no tool wear, making it an ideal choice for working with hard materials that would quickly wear down traditional cutting tools.

EDM machining services also offer the benefit of producing parts with a high surface finish Because the process uses electrical discharges to remove material, there is minimal force applied to the workpiece, resulting in a smooth and uniform surface finish This is important for applications where surface quality is critical, such as in the medical or aerospace industries.

EDM is capable of achieving accuracy on the micron level, making it ideal for applications where precision is crucial This makes it a popular choice for industries such as electronics, where components must fit together with tight tolerances to ensure proper functioning.

In addition to these benefits, EDM machining services offer the advantage of being able to produce prototypes quickly and cost-effectively Because EDM is a non-contact process, there is no tool wear, meaning that the same level of precision can be achieved on the first part as on the last This makes it an ideal choice for rapid prototyping and short production runs, as there is no need for expensive tooling or setup costs.
